// Bounce processor client setup.
// This client connects to the Mailsift internal bounce-ingest service,
// which classifies hard vs. soft bounces and schedules suppression-list
// updates. Retries are handled upstream, so do NOT add retry logic here;
// duplicate submissions will double-count bounce metrics. The client
// requires an ingest credential scoped to the bounce pipeline only.
// The key for the ingest service is set immediately below.

service key, fawip-bajef: kto11_Qt5wZK9vdNC

# Artifact Signing — Export Service

Heads up, future maintainers: the Tallygrove spreadsheet exporter used to balloon to 2 GB on big workbooks, so we switched to streaming rows and now sign the export binary per release. Memory sits around 180 MB these days. Builds won't deploy unless the artifact is signed. Verify each release against the key below.

signing key of bagap-yawep = bky13_TbfT6ZMUoGJo2

# Configuration for the Lexigrab string-extraction script.
# Plugin authors: Lexigrab scans your plugin's `strings/` directory and
# pushes extracted keys to the Wordloom translation hub. Keep
# EXTRACT_LOCALE_DEFAULT=en and do not change SCAN_DEPTH past 4, or
# nested templates will be skipped. The hub upload authenticates with a
# per-plugin secret, set on the next line.

sealed setting: ARCHIVE_KEY3=8d0